Summary of request

On Saturday (October 3), the Mayor published a report on air quality improvements in London, ‘Air Quality in London 2016-2020, London Environment Strategy: Air Quality Impact Evaluation’. Table 13 of the report is titled 'Education establishments in locations exceeding the legal limit for NO2’, and identifies 34 education establishments in the capital that exceeded the legal limit in 2019.

 

Please provide:

 

1. The name of each of these 34 education establishments identified in the report.

2. A breakdown of the above (Question 1) indicating which are:   a. Primary schools b. Secondary schools c. 16 plus d. Higher education institutions e. Other independent schools f. Other

3. The yearly average level of NO2 per cubic metre at each education establishment’s location in 2019 (the term “location” used here is a reference to the title of Table 13 in the report, as referenced above. I would expect you to understand it in the same way as the report does).

4. The number of hourly average spikes above 200 micrograms of NO2 per cubic metre at each education establishment’s location in 2019 (the term “location” used here is a reference to the title of Table 13 in the report, as referenced above. I would expect you to understand it in the same way as the report does).
